Fuel
Wood stoves can burn a variety of fuels which include dry wood, as well as manufactured solid fuels, such as briquettes or fire logs. These fuels that are clean burning are more environmentally friendly than traditional house coal and wet wood, so are more sustainable and safer to use. They do emit harmful smoke and gases, and require regular maintenance to perform at their best.
Read the instructions of the manufacturer prior to buying or using any kind of fuel. Be sure that it's the right fuel for your stove. The wrong fuel can cause damage to your stove and chimney which can result in costly repairs or invalidating the warranty. It could be illegal to use fuel that is not approved particularly in smoke control zones. Check for the 'Ready to Burn logo, which demonstrates that the fuel is in compliance with the smoke emission and sulphur limits and can be legally sold for domestic use. The logo is usually displayed along with the price and details about the brand or on the packaging.
The appropriate fuels are prepared (stored and then split for a few months prior to use) or kiln-dried to reduce the moisture content which boosts heat output and efficiency in combustion. The type of wood you select must also be suited to your heating needs. Softwoods like pine and spruce provide good value heat but hardwoods like beech and oak produce a higher output of hot embers over a longer period of time. Fruitwoods such as apple and cherry not only offer efficient heating, but also elevate the ambiance by releasing pleasant aromas.
If you own a stove that uses multiple fuels, you may be interested in a mixed fuel fire. Combining Smokeless Briquettes with wood will help maintain the flames for longer and keep your home warm. The briquettes are a good alternative and can stop a chimney fire by keeping the air moving.

Design
Wood stoves are a great source of heat, however their design is crucial to consider. Unwanted byproducts from combustion, like smoke and carbon monoxide, can be harmful to environmental and health impacts. The key to minimizing the emission of these gases is to ensure proper operation and a careful design.
Modern wood stoves are designed to be more environmentally conscious than traditional models. All EPA-certified stoves comply with strict emission and energy efficiency regulations that maximize the quantity of heat they generate. Look for an iron EPA certification mark on the back of the stove, or go through the EPA's latest database to determine whether a particular stove is certified. Hearth stores in your area can also be a great source to learn more about wood stoves, and the size and capacity that is the best fit for your space.
A key part of the EPA emission regulations involves controlling the flow of air through the stove. The firebox of the stove is surrounded by walls made of fireproof materials and air vents are located in the walls to ensure controlled airflow. Controlling airflow is vital to ensure that the combustion is optimal and emissions are minimized.
Modern stoves often have baffles that prolong the amount of time that the fire burns which reduces the amount fumes and harmful gases. Certain wood stoves include a catalytic converter to reduce NOx emissions. This type of system is more expensive and is typically only used in high-end wood stoves.
Stoves use different types air control systems to regulate air flow. The majority of wood stoves employ a basic passive air supply which requires the owner (you) to operate the stove in order to achieve peak performance. Some wood stoves also come with active air supplies, which are controlled by sensors that track the combustion process and adjust the flow of air based on the need.

The output of heat
Many wood stoves are advertised as having a peak heat output rate in BTUs. This is not true however, since the actual capacity of a wood stove is dependent on a variety of factors such as the size of the room as well as how well it's insulated.
The climate of the region can also influence heat demands. To maintain comfort, colder regions need stoves with higher BTU ratings.
go here of wood and the frequency at which you replenish your fireplace are other elements that affect the amount of heat produced. Dry, seasoned firewood creates more heat than freshly cut and wet logs. A stove fan can also aid in the circulation of heat produced by the wood stove in the room, rather than having the hot air rise up.
It is crucial to remember that the maximum output of wood heaters is not to be reached often since continuous high fire can cause damage to a stove's innards and can cause carbon monoxide to leak into the home.
Regular refueling can improve the efficiency of the fireplace. Make sure that the log isn't too big and placed on the glowing embers, so it does not touch the glass or the walls of the stove. It's also recommended to add smaller logs more often rather than allowing too long between additions.
High efficiency stoves are designed to provide a higher heat output with the same amount of fuel. This is achieved by prewarming combustion air and using other design features. They produce less carbon monoxide, toxins, and smoke than earlier models.
Some people choose to install boiler stoves as element of their heating system. It uses the heat produced by the wood-burning stove to heat the water in hot water tanks or a central heating system, allowing the heat to be distributed throughout the house. This is a more efficient and economical method to heat a home even though the installation process is quite lengthy. This method requires an additional flue and the energy needed to run a boiler will increase overall costs.
Safety
Wood stoves and fireplaces are a convenient and attractive method of heating your home. However, they're not free of dangers. A fire could cause furniture or carpets to catch fire and a hot fireplace can cause structural damage to your home. Proper use and maintenance of a wood-burning stove reduces these dangers.
To keep wood-burning stoves safe and in good condition they must be regularly inspected and maintained. This includes checking the chimney and flue for signs of wear and rust, and cleaning them at least two times per year. The chimney should also be inspected every season for creosote buildup. This is extremely flammable and could cause chimney fires.

When you are buying a fireplace that burns wood select one that is certified by Underwriters Laboratories or another recognized testing laboratory. This ensures that the stove meets the safety standards of the federal government and is designed to ventilate properly. Also, you should inspect the hinges, legs and grates of the stove to make sure they are in good working order and are securely fastened to the floor.
If you opt to install a wood-burning fireplace in your home, ensure that the floor beneath it is reinforced and made of non-combustible materials. You might also want to lay a piece of non-combustible floor tiles on top of the flooring that is in place, especially when you live in an old mobile home with combustible floors.
Only burn wood that is dry and seasoned. Green and damp wood produces excessive smoke and creosote. This flammable byproduct could build up inside your chimney, which releases toxic chemicals. Do not burn cardboard or trash, paper, or any other combustibles because they can release dangerous fumes, and may not even ignite.
Never "over fire" your wood stove -that is, to generate a larger flame than the stove is able to handle. Overfiring can cause flames escape from the combustion chamber, which can damage to the stove, chimney connector, as well as the chimney itself. It can also burn other materials that are combustible in your home. It is also crucial to make sure the fire is fully extinguished prior to leaving your home or going to sleep. Finally, you should always have working smoke and carbon monoxide alarms in your home.
